| Inspection |
| 1. |
Connect the GDS on the Data Link Connector (DLC).
|
| 2. |
Measure the output voltage of the RPS at idle and various engine speed.
|
| Removal |
| 1. |
Turn the ignition switch OFF and disconnect the battery negative (-)
cable.
|
| 2. |
Release the residual pressure in fuel line.
(Refer to Fuel Delivery System - "Release Residual Pressure in Fuel
Line")
|
| 3. |
Remove the alternator.
(Refer to Charging System - "Alternator")
|
| 4. |
Disconnect the rail pressure sensor connector (A), and then remove the
sensor (B) from the delivery pipe.
|
| Installation |
|
| 1. |
Install in the reverse order of removal.

If it is necessary to rock the vehicle to free it from snow, sand, or mud, first
turn the steering wheel right and left to clear the area around your front wheels.
Then, shift back and forth between R (Reverse) and a forward gear.
Try to avoid spinning the wheels, and do not race the engine.
